In recent years, the topic of life insurance has gained significant attention in the United States. With the rising cost of living and increasing healthcare expenses, many individuals are looking for ways to secure their families' financial future. California, in particular, has been at the forefront of this trend, with a growing number of residents seeking out life insurance policies to protect their loved ones. But what exactly is a California life insurance policy, and why is it becoming so popular?

The US life insurance market has seen a significant increase in demand for life insurance policies, particularly in California. According to recent data, the state accounts for over 15% of the country's life insurance policies, with many residents seeking out policies to protect their families, cover funeral expenses, and pay off outstanding debts.

California Life Insurance Policy: A Growing Concern in the US

A California life insurance policy is a contract between an individual and an insurance company, where the individual pays premiums in exchange for a death benefit. This benefit is paid out to the policyholder's beneficiaries in the event of their passing. The policyholder can choose from various types of policies, including term life, whole life, and universal life, each with its own set of features and benefits.
